CHICKEN BOMBS R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Chicken Bombs Recipe - Food.com image

Have not tried this but it's up soon. It's got so many of my favorite ingredients. Putting here for safekeeping! Original recipe can be found at http://dishingwithleslie.blogspot.com/2012/09/chicken-bombs.html --

Total Time 45 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 30 minutes

Yield 10 bombs, 5 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

5 boneless skinless chicken breasts
5 jalapenos, sliced in half lengthwise and cleaned
20 slices bacon
4 ounces cream cheese, softened
1 cup colby-monterey jack cheese or 1 cup cheddar cheese, shredded
salt and pepper
1 cup barbecue sauce

Steps:

  • Slice chicken breasts in half (like a hamburger bun). Place in a plastic food bag and pound until 1/4" thick.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Mix the 2 cheeses together and smear about 1 tablespoons into each pepper half (use up the cheese between all of the peppers).
  • Place the pepper on the chicken breast and wrap it up as best you can. I suggest placing the pepper cheese side down so it gets completely covered by the chicken. Wrap each chicken breast completely with two pieces of bacon. Start at one end, wrap half the breast and finish the 2nd half with the other piece of bacon.
  • Cook on a preheated 350 degree grill over indirect for 30 minutes or until chicken is done. Turn every 5 minutes and baste with barbecue sauce each time you turn it.
  • For oven: Bake at 375 degrees for 30 minutes or until chicken is done. Baste a couple times with the barbecue sauce and finish under the broiler to set the BBQ sauce. ~~I suggest a 400 degree oven and no BBQ sauce for the first 20 minutes, turning once to help cook the bacon. Then reduce heat to 375, change pans to loose some of the bacon fat, cover with BBQ sauce and and finish baking/broiling.

CHICKEN BOMBS WITH BACON AND JALAPENOS RECIPE | ALLRECIPES



Chicken Bombs with Bacon and Jalapenos Recipe | Allrecipes image

One of our favorite grilling dishes.

Provided by Debbie 414

Categories     Meat and Poultry    Chicken    Breast

Total Time 1 hours 0 minutes

Prep Time 30 minutes

Cook Time 30 minutes

Yield 10 chicken bombs

Number Of Ingredients 8

5 (4 ounce) skinless, boneless chicken breast halves
sal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
1?¼ c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ese
½ (8 ounce) package cream cheese
5 jalapeno peppers, halved and seeded
30 slices bacon
roasting string
½ cup barbecue sauce, or to taste

Steps:

  • Preheat a gas grill for medium heat (350 degrees F (175 degrees C)), or arrange charcoal briquettes on one side of the barbeque. Lightly oil the grate.
  • Slice chicken breasts in half lengthwise. Transfer to a resealable plastic bag, seal, and pound to 1/4-inch thickness with a meat mallet.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Mix Monterey Jack cheese and cream cheese together in a bowl. Fill jalapeno halves with cheese mixture, using about 1 tablespoon in each one.
  • Place 1 stuffed jalapeno with the cheese side down in the middle of each chicken breast half; fold into a pouch. Wrap each chicken breast completely with three pieces of bacon. Tie 4 ways with roasting string.
  • Cook on the preheated grill over indirect heat, turning every 5 minutes and basting with barbecue sauce, until juices run clear, about 30 minutes.

CHICKEN BOMBS - BIGOVEN
""
From bigoven.com
Reviews 0
Total Time 30 minutes
Cuisine not set
Calories 1686 calories per serving
  • "Preheat oven or grill to 350 degrees. Slice chicken breasts in half WIDTH wise (Each half will make 1 Chicken Bomb). Place between two pieces of wax paper and pound to ¼ inch thickness. A rolling pin also does the trick. Season each with salt a pepper. Slice jalapeños in half LENGTH wise and remove seeds, ribs, and the end with the stem. In a small bowl, mix your softened cream cheese with your grated colby jack. Fill each jalapeño half with about 1 TBSP cheese mixture. Place 1 jalapeño half at the end of each pounded breast piece. Roll over and together. It doesn't always close the way you think it should. No worries! The bacon will pull it all together. Wrap each breast piece with 2 slices of bacon and wrap kinda tightly and tuck the ends of the bacon under the strips. It all comes together in the cooking process. If you have trouble with the roll staying together, you may opt to use a toothpick. TO GRILL: Place on grill using INDIRECT heat.and cook for 20-25 minutes, turning every 4-5 minutes. Baste chicken with BBQ sauce each time you turn it, giving it one final basting right before it's done. Chicken is ready when it reaches an internal temp of 165 degrees. If you don't have a meat thermometer, pierce chicken with a fork. If juices run clear, it's done! TO BAKE IN OVEN: Bake, uncovered, at 375 degrees for 30 minutes. Basting with BBQ sauce a few times during cooking. Baste once again when finished, and place under broil setting for a few minutes so bacon can crisp completely."

BEST BUFFALO CHICKEN BOMB RECIPE - HOW TO MAKE BUFFALO ...
Buffalo sauce lovers will die over these Buffalo Chicken Bombs from Delish.com.
From delish.com
Total Time 35 minutes
Category appetizers
  • Preheat oven to 375°. Spray an 8" round baking pan or pie dish with cooking spray. In a medium bowl, combine the chicken, buffalo sauce, and sour cream (or mayonnaise). Flatten each biscuit round to about ¼” thickness. Top each round of dough with a scoop of the chicken mixture and a cube of cheese. Bring the edges of the dough together and pinch to seal. Place in pan seam side-down. In a small bowl, mix the butter, parsley, and chives. Brush the tops of the dough balls with the butter mixture. Bake until the biscuits are golden and cooked through, about 20 to 25 minutes. Drizzle with ranch dressing and serve warm.
